What’s the surface area of a regular pyramid if the base is 7 and the height is 10

the base is a square, and then there are four triangles that meet at their tip.

so you need to find the area of the base, and the four triangles.

base-l*w=7*7=49

triangles=1/2*b*h*4=1/2*7*10*4=35*4=140

140+49=189
